How To Fix CNV_20400_CHECK092 - Template &1 enviroment &2 exists in multiple source controlling areas


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CNV_20400_CHECK - Messages for check functions (controlling area merge)

  • Message number: 092

  • Message text: Template &1 enviroment &2 exists in multiple source controlling areas

  • What causes this issue?

    The controlling area mapping states, that certain controlling areas will
    be merged. Some of these use CO templates (Activity-Based Costing). If
    two or more controlling areas are to be merged that use the same
    template name in the same environment the templates cannot be
    distinguished after the merge. Therefore the templates must be renamed
    before merging the controlling areas.
    Note that the content of the CO templates will not be converted.

    System Response

    Template &V1& environment &V2& exists in multiple source controlling
    areas

    How to fix this error?

    Decide which of the source templates you want to rename. Call
    transaction CPT1 and create a copy of the templates. Reassign the
    objects that use the old template to the copy of the template
    (transaction KTPF, KS02, CP02, KEKW, KEI3 - depending on your
    customizing). Delete the old template by using transaction CPT1.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message CNV_20400_CHECK092 - Template &1 enviroment &2 exists in multiple source controlling areas ?

    The SAP error message CNV_20400_CHECK092 indicates that a template (identified by &1) in a specific environment (identified by &2) exists in multiple source controlling areas. This typically occurs during data migration or conversion processes, particularly when using SAP's Conversion Tools or Data Migration tools.

    Cause:

    The error arises when the system detects that the same template is associated with more than one controlling area in the source system. This can lead to ambiguity during the migration process, as the system cannot determine which controlling area to use for the template.

    Solution:

    To resolve this error, you can follow these steps:

    1. Identify the Templates: Check the templates in the source system to identify where the duplicates exist. You can do this by querying the relevant tables or using transaction codes that allow you to view controlling area configurations.

    2. Consolidate Templates: If possible, consolidate the templates so that each template is unique to a single controlling area. This may involve modifying the templates or creating new ones that are specific to each controlling area.

    3. Adjust Migration Settings: If the templates are meant to be used across multiple controlling areas, you may need to adjust the migration settings or the logic in your migration program to handle this scenario appropriately.

    4. Consult Documentation: Review the SAP documentation related to the specific migration tool you are using. There may be specific guidelines or best practices for handling templates and controlling areas.

    5. Testing: After making the necessary adjustments, perform a test migration to ensure that the error is resolved and that the data is being migrated correctly.

    6. Seek Support: If you are unable to resolve the issue, consider reaching out to SAP support or consulting with an SAP expert who has experience with data migration and conversion processes.
